What is a remote automotive designer?

Remote Automotive Designers are professionals who create and develop vehicle concepts, designs, and models while working from a location outside of a traditional in-office environment. They use digital tools and software to collaborate with teams, visualize ideas, and refine vehicle aesthetics and functionality. This role typically involves tasks like sketching, 3D modeling, and virtual meetings to communicate design concepts. Remote Automotive Designers need strong creative, technical, and communication skills, as well as the ability to adapt to digital workflows. What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ote automotive designer?

To thrive as a Remote Automotive Designer, you need a solid background in industrial or automotive design, proficiency in CAD software,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with tools like Autodesk Alias, CATIA, and Adobe Creative Suite, as well as experience with virtual collaboration platforms, is typically required. Strong creativity, effective commun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for excelling in a remote and collaborative environment. These skills and qualities ensure innovative vehicle designs, efficient teamwork, and the ability to deliver high-quality work independently in a distributed setting.

How do remote automotive designers typically collaborate with engineering and manufacturing teams?

Remote Automotive Designers frequently use digital collaboration tools, such as CAD software, shared design platforms, and video conferencing, to work closely with engineering and manufacturing teams. Regular virtual meetings and feedback sessions ensure that design intentions align with technical and production constraints. Effective communication and timely file sharing are essential for resolving issues quickly and maintaining project momentum, even when team members are in different locations.

We're looking for an experienced industrial designer to be part of our new hardware design team at an early and exciting moment for the company. This is a fully hands-on role - sketching, modelling, prototyping, and detailing real hardware, and whatever else the mission demands. There is no team to manage and no agency to brief; your artistic talent is front and center and your own hands are on the work. You'll work directly with our design leadership and with the engineers building the hardware, in a team being built for people who care as much about the craft as the mission.

RESPONSIBILITIES - hands-on hardware design
  • Help us build our family of products. Take hardware from concept to production - sketch, model, prototype, refine, and detail
  • Work through the real compromises with hardware engineering - packaging, thermal, structural, harness routing - and keep the design intent alive on the other side
  • Prototype physically and quickly. Print it, mock it up, hold it, and be honest about what you learn
  • Produce the renders, animations, and drawings that let executives, customers, and manufacturing partners see exactly what we intend to build
  • Bring impeccable design and artistic vision into everything we do, make us stand out

QUALIFICATIONS - We hire for talent and potential, not pedigree.
  • Show us an amazing portfolio of hardware you designed - including the sketches and the ugly middle, not only the hero renders
  • Strong surfacing and CAD skills in whatever you're fastest in, and comfort working from and back into engineering CAD
  • Practical manufacturing knowledge - machining, sheet metal, additive, molding, coatings and finishes - and a habit of designing for how a thing actually gets made
  • Consumer, automotive, aerospace, robotics, medical, and industrial equipment backgrounds all fit. Defense and space knowledge is great, we don't expect it
  • An active security clearance is a bonus, not a requirement
  • We work in Adobe Creative Suite, Blender or Cinema 4D for visualization, and alongside engineering CAD - comfort with these is a plus, mastery of your own toolset matters more
